    Abstract: A computer program product and method for sales forecasting and adjusting a sales forecast for an enterprise in a configurable region having one or more clusters of stores. The method includes periodically receiving a sales forecast for an enterprise over a configurable period of time, periodically receiving actual sales information, sales anomalies and anticipated events within the at least one of the clusters of stores over a computer network, determining positive and negative deviations from the anticipated sales of the sales forecast based on the sales information, determining whether one or more trends are occurring or have occurred using a pre-defined mathematical expression based on the sales information, the positive and negative deviations, and the sales anomalies, adjusting the anticipated sales of the sales forecast based on the sales anomalies, the trends and the anticipated events, and outputting the adjusted sales forecast to a user.

    Abstract: A system, computer program product and method for optimized execution in a value chain network. The value chain network has shared access to a shared database on a service provider computer over a network. The computer program product and method receives a request for an order for goods or services from a first company in the value chain network, searches for one or more second companies having matching goods or services in the value chain network, sources the matched one or more second companies, creates a plan over one or more segments to effect the movement of the good or services, involves one or more third companies, from a source location to a destination location, manages the handoffs between the relevant first, second and third companies in order to ship the goods or services, determines demand for the goods or services from the first company in the value chain network, receives changes or anomalies to the plan over one or more segments, and optimizes execution of the plan during its execution.

    Abstract: A system, computer program product and method for a global transaction manager in a federated value chain network. The federated value chain network includes a plurality of local networks having shared access to two or more shared databases on a service provider computer over a network via a database router module. The computer program product includes receiving a request for an order for goods or services from a first company in one of the plurality of local networks in the federated value chain network, searching for one or more second companies having matching goods or services over one or more of the plurality of local networks, sourcing the matched one or more second companies, creating a transaction over one or more segments to effect the movement of the good or services, involving one or more third companies, from a source location to a destination location, and managing the handoffs between the relevant first, second and third companies in order to ship the goods or services.

    Abstract: A system and computer program product for providing targeted marketing. The system includes a plurality of remote computers, a central server, a network interface in communication with the central server and the plurality of remote computers over a network, and a shared database in communication with the central server. The network interface is configured to provide targeted marketing. The central server is configured to collect user product data in a user profile from a user, collect vendor product data in a vendor profile from one or more vendors, compare the user profile, including information derived from the user product data, to the vendor product data, and present the user with content based on the comparison. The user product data includes one or more categories of products of interest defined by the user. The vendor product data includes one or more categories of products offered for sale by the one or more vendors.
